I love when Raids have mechanics... And i want to create this *Mechanic on this raid i am creating.

 

What i want to do and i am asking to see if i can do this is :

 

I Want to place a boss in the middle of a big room... 

 

I Want the Mobs (Not Raid Mobs) to get aggro when you hit the boss Like Protecting him...

But when you hit the mobs... (again not the Raid Mobs) to make the boss ignore that.

 

Hit the boss u get the Whole room on you because they are soldiers and they will help their lord...

But the Raid dont attack when you hit the monsters on the room Except when you hit him or the raid mobs.

 

And i dont want the whole room to attack you when u hit one mob...  just the mobs that are close to that mob and you.

u can play with checks ...

 

in doAttack() method you should check if the attacker is gonna hit your boss and then control the mobs you want , send attack

take an example:

if (this instanceof L2PcInstance && target instanceof L2MonsterInstance)
{
	L2MonsterInstance boss = (L2MonsterInstance) target;
	if (boss.getNpcId() == your boss id)
	{
		for (L2Character mob : boss.getKnownList().getKnownCharactersInRadius(your radius))
		{
			if (mob instanceof L2MonsterInstance && !((L2MonsterInstance)mob).isRaid())
			{
				((L2MonsterInstance)mob).getAI().setIntention(CtrlIntention.AI_INTENTION_ATTACK, this);
			}
		}
	}
}

It's basically clan faction system, but for the specific case of RB, you have to deny aggro. Simply write a faction name for all case, and for rb case you can write ignoredId (implemented for aCis, not sure about your pack). It's even part of retail behavior, where some mobs will defend but some won't.

 

Example of blood queen :

<ai type="DEFAULT" ssCount="0" ssRate="0" spsCount="0" spsRate="0" aggro="500" clan="cave_servant_clan" clanRange="400" ignoredIds="20237;20273;20238;20274;20239;20275;20240;20276;20246;20277;20134;20287" canMove="true" seedable="true"/>
		

She got a clan, but won't help any of ignoredIds. If you haven't ignoredIds system, you can simply port aCis version.

 

If your room is big you can use clanRange to adjust the "spread aggro".
